Antiquities Minister Khaled El Enani
Alexandria - MENA

Antiquities Minister Khaled El Enani underlined the importance of the Alexandria International Conference on Maritime and Underwater Archaeology, which is held for the first time in Alexandria. 

As many as 25 researchers from 11 countries, including the US, Russia, Egypt, Japan, France and Tunisia, are taking part in the conference. 

During the inauguration of the conference at the Bibliotheca Alexandrina on Monday, Enani said that the researchers who are taking part in the conference represent major international universities. 

The conference comes as part of promoting cooperation between the Bibliotheca Alexandrina and the Antiquities Ministry on the occasion marking the 20th anniversary of establishing the administration of underwater archaeology, he added. 

Alexandria has an administration of underwater archaeology, which contributed to exploring several archaeological wealth, he said.
